"The photovoltaic solar energy market is beginning in Romania and only up to 200 KV have been installed across the country – enough power to supply households of about 500 residents.
The most active company is Dutch-based Girasolar Romania, which is working with state-owned Electrica to install photovoltaic panels in Floresti, near Ploiesti. The firm provides equipment and design for photovoltaic solar panel installations.
On average, a household of five needs an installed power capacity of between two to three KV. The investment can reach about 15,000 Euro per household, if the panels are connected to the grid. An ambitious project to install panels on the roof of the Parliament Palace in Bucharest to generate electricity have failed so far. This one building uses the energy of a town of 25,000, which means it would need 15 MW of installed power capacity in photovoltaic panels - a 45 million Euro investment. β€œThe Palace is so large that when the administrator replaced incandescent light bulbs with energy efficient tubes, it reduced power consumption for lighting by 60 per cent,” says Nicolae Floristean, general manager at Girasolar Romania.
The firm plans to invest 15 million Euro in a production facility for an annual capacity of 22 MW photovoltaic panels in Romania. 'We are in discussions to see if we could benefit from European funds,' says Floristean."
